Overview

The SIUE School of Business provides a high-quality, accessible business education that empowers learners to make a difference in a dynamic, diverse, and connected world. Key elements of our mission High quality: We provide a high-quality business education by: (1) offering business programs that are accredited by the AACSB; (2) creating a learning environment for undergraduate, graduate, and continuing education students that fosters creativity, critical thinking, ethical behavior, sociocultural competence, and appreciation of global issues; (3) placing a strong emphasis on the application of cutting-edge business practices and technology in our business programs; (4) hiring and retaining faculty that deliver a business curriculum based on the combination of contemporary research, relevant business practice, and teaching effectiveness. Accessible: Our education is accessible in several ways: (1) we offer courses in fully online, hybrid, and traditional face-to-face formats, depending upon our students’ and degree programs’ characteristics; (2) we foster a welcoming community for students from a diverse set of backgrounds by being sensitive to their social and educational concerns; (3) we connect students with the business community in the St. Louis metropolitan area; (4) we have faculty that are excited to engage with students both during and outside of class. A dynamic, diverse, and connected world: We prepare our students to function and thrive in a rapidly changing global business environment by developing an appreciation of different world views, an international perspective, and technological skills in the business curriculum.

The SIUE School of Business offers an innovative curriculum designed to help students develop the professional skills and knowledge required to excel in today's global environment. Students study abroad, attend professional networking events, and participate in student organizations to enrich their academic experience and prepare for careers in business leadership. The Business Transitions program introduces students to individual responsibility, ethical behavior, business etiquette, global perspectives, and personal financial planning. SIUE's proximity to St. Louis allows business students to gain real-world experience. Students find internships, cooperative education opportunities, and full-time jobs with major corporations such as The Boeing Company, Nestle Purina, Emerson, Enterprise, AB InBev, and Edward Jones, to name a few. For the 18th consecutive year the Princeton Review lists the SIUE School of Business as an outstanding business school, and recommends the School as one of the best institutions in the U.S. from which students can earn an MBA. Undergraduate and graduate degrees are offered in accounting, computer management and information systems, economics, finance, management, and marketing.
